Co-operators across India celebrate 73rd R Day with gusto
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

On the occasion of Republic Day, the news is pouring in from across the country about cooperative leaders celebrating the 73rd Republic Day with great enthusiasm.

From national level Cooperatives to the state level to district level to village level, co-ops have unfurled the national flag at their respective premises and celebrated the day with full gusto.

In his message on the occasion, National Cooperative Union of India President Dileepbhai Sanghani said, “On this day I urge fellow co-operators to take an oath to take the cooperative movement to newer heights. Happy Republic Day!”

IFFCO Managing Director Dr. U S Awasthi wished the country well through social media and wrote, “Congratulations to everyone. Today on the auspicious occasion of 73rd #RepublicDay; #IFFCO has successfully crossed the production of 2 Crore bottles of truly #MakeInIndia innovative environment-friendly #IFFCONanoUrea for farmers across the world. @narendramodi @Dileep_Sanghani”.

Besides, IFFCO senior officials unfurled the National Flag at the IFFCO Township in Gurugram, amidst large numbers of IFFCO employees and their family members attending the celebrations.

On the occasion, Kribhco’s official Twitter handle wrote, “KRIBHCO wishes everyone a very happy #RepublicDay”.

NCDC’s MD Sundeep Nayak unfurled the national flag at its headquarters in New Delhi in the presence of senior officials and shared the photos on social media. He wrote, “Republic Day Celebrations at National Cooperative Development Corporation”.

The official Twitter handle of Saraswat Bank wrote, “Let’s celebrate the indomitable spirit of India, this #RepublicDay!”. Similarly, Cosmos Co-operative bank wrote, “Let us celebrate our right to protect our wealth. Cosmos Bank wishes you a Happy Republic Day!’.

News of the celebrations by cooperators also came in from Bihar, Uttarakhand, Chhattisgarh, and other parts of the country. Leaders also unfurled the tricolor on the occasion.

Biscomaun Chairman, Dr. Sunil Kumar Singh also took to social media to greet the fellow cooperators and wrote, “Hearty congratulations and best wishes on the occasion of Republic Day”.

Many Uttarakhand-based cooperative institutions including Uttarakhand State Cooperative Federation, Uttarakhand State Cooperative Bank, Haridwar District Cooperative Bank, and other primary level co-operatives had lined up to celebrate the Republic Day at their respective places.

Besides, Maharashtra-based Kaijs Bank unfurled the flag in the premises of the bank in the presence of bank directors and officials.

Rajya Sabha Member of Parliament from Rajasthan Rajendra Gehlot participated in the event organized by the Jodhpur Nagari Sahakari Bank on the occasion of Republic Day.

Sanjeev Kumar Mittal, IAS, Secretary (Cooperation)-cum-Registrar of Cooperative Societies of Andaman & Nicobar unfurled the National flag as a mark to the 73rd Republic Day celebrations at RCS Office. Port Blair.

The tableau from the Northeast state of Meghalaya that participated at the Republic Day parade in New Delhi on Wednesday was one of the main attractions of the event as it paid tribute to women-led cooperative societies.

The PACs spread across the country celebrated the day with full joy.
